Colitis encompasses chronic inflammatory conditions of the digestive tract, such as Ulcerative Colitis and Crohn’s Disease, which fall under the umbrella of Inflammatory Bowel Disease (IBD). These conditions involve persistent inflammation that damages the lining of the gastrointestinal tract, leading to debilitating symptoms. For individuals living with IBD, managing daily life involves carefully scrutinizing environmental and lifestyle factors, including diet and alcohol consumption. A common question is whether consuming alcoholic beverages can directly worsen the disease course or trigger an acute flare-up of symptoms. Understanding how alcohol interacts with an already compromised digestive system is important for making informed decisions about consumption.
How Alcohol Affects Gut Permeability and Inflammation
Alcohol, specifically ethanol, exerts a direct toxic effect on the delicate lining of the intestine, compromising the gut’s barrier function. The intestinal wall relies on a protective layer of mucus and specialized proteins called tight junctions to regulate what passes into the body. Alcohol consumption damages the mucus layer and causes a breakdown of these tight junctions, which include proteins like occludin and claudins.
This damage leads to increased intestinal permeability, or “leaky gut,” where the barrier becomes porous. When the junctions loosen, unwanted substances from the gut lumen, such as bacterial products and toxins, can pass through the epithelial layer and enter the bloodstream. A primary concern is the translocation of lipopolysaccharide (LPS), a potent endotoxin derived from the cell walls of certain gut bacteria.
Once LPS enters the circulation, it triggers a strong systemic immune response, fueling the pre-existing chronic inflammation characteristic of Colitis. Alcohol also disrupts the balance of the gut microbiome, known as dysbiosis, by decreasing beneficial bacteria while allowing potentially pathogenic strains, such as Proteobacteria, to flourish. This microbial imbalance further compromises the barrier and contributes to the inflammatory cycle within the colon.
Alcohol’s Role in Triggering Symptom Flares
Many patients report a direct correlation between alcohol intake and the acute worsening of their daily gastrointestinal symptoms. Alcohol acts as a gut stimulant, which increases intestinal motility and leads to immediate discomfort. The most commonly reported symptoms following consumption are:
- Increased frequency of diarrhea.
- Abdominal pain.
- Cramping.
- A heightened sense of urgency.
The type of alcoholic beverage consumed also plays a role, as non-alcohol components often act as additional irritants. Carbonated drinks, such as beer and sparkling mixers, can cause excessive gas and bloating, which is painful in an inflamed intestine. Many alcoholic beverages contain high levels of added sugar or artificial sweeteners, which draw water into the colon, exacerbating diarrhea.
While some studies suggest that components in red wine, such as polyphenols, might possess anti-inflammatory properties, this potential benefit is outweighed by the detrimental effect of the ethanol itself on gut permeability. The risk of triggering a flare depends significantly on the amount and frequency of alcohol consumed. Heavy or binge drinking is strongly associated with adverse outcomes and increased risk of relapse. Abstinence is generally advised during any period of active disease.
Potential Interactions with Colitis Medications
A serious consideration for patients with Colitis is the potential for alcohol to interact dangerously with prescribed medications, leading to severe side effects or reduced drug effectiveness. Many immunosuppressive and disease-modifying drugs used to manage IBD are metabolized by the liver, the same organ responsible for processing alcohol.
Combining alcohol with immunomodulators like Methotrexate or Azathioprine (and its derivative, 6-Mercaptopurine) significantly increases the risk of hepatotoxicity, or drug-induced liver damage. Since these medications already place a metabolic burden on the liver, the addition of alcohol substantially elevates the likelihood of developing liver fibrosis or other serious complications.
Alcohol can also interfere with the absorption and metabolism of other Colitis treatments, potentially lowering their concentration in the bloodstream and reducing their therapeutic effect. This interference compromises a patient’s ability to maintain remission, leading to disease progression. Furthermore, alcohol increases the risk of gastrointestinal bleeding, which is amplified when combined with certain anti-inflammatory drugs. Corticosteroids like Prednisone, and non-steroidal anti-inflammatory drugs (NSAIDs), irritate the stomach lining, and alcohol consumption alongside them compounds the risk of developing ulcers or upper gastrointestinal hemorrhage.
Practical Advice for Managing Alcohol Consumption
Given the potential for alcohol to increase inflammation, trigger symptoms, and interact negatively with medication, the safest approach for patients with Colitis is often complete abstinence. During an active flare or a period of high disease activity, avoiding alcohol is strongly recommended to aid in intestinal healing and prevent dehydration.
For patients in deep, sustained remission who have the approval of their gastroenterologist, moderation is paramount. Conservative guidelines suggest limiting intake to a very occasional drink, never exceeding one standard drink per day. Even moderate consumption may increase subclinical markers of inflammation. If a patient chooses to consume alcohol, selecting lower-irritant options may help mitigate immediate symptoms, such as avoiding carbonated beverages, high-sugar mixers, and drinks with a high concentration of sulfites. Any decision regarding alcohol consumption must be discussed with a healthcare provider to assess specific risks related to current medications and overall disease status.
